Rodin Museum: a bite sized sculpture museum

by jaseroque Epinions Most Popular Authors - Top 1000, Dec 14 '99
Pros: small, can be done in an hour or two
Cons: may be too small for your first trip
Rodin, sculptor of "The Thinker," "The Gates of Hell," and the "Burghers of Calais" lived and worked in this house in Paris for almost fifteen years.

Daytrip From Paris - Chartres

by lhs31 , Sep 06 '00
Pros: Amazing architecture, quaint town, beautiful art
Cons: Not fun for the children
*This review also appears in the general France Travel section.

Chartes Cathedral is the centerpiece of a small, sleepy town southwest of Paris. It contains a relic, a piece of fabric believed to have been worn by the Virgin Mary as she gave...
